Accident Summary Nr: 14252241 - Employee falls when ceiling joist breaks under weight

Abstract: At approximately 8:15 a.m. on March 2, 1990, Employee #1 went up on the roof to check on his crew and to show plumbers where the drain pipes were to be located. The first decking had not been installed on the flat portion of the roof. Ceiling joists, 2 in. by 6 in., had been installed and Employee #1 was stepping on these joists when a 4 ft 6 in. joist broke under his weight, causing him to fall 12 ft 4 in. to the concrete floor and breaking an adjacent joist as he fell. Employee #1 suffered cuts to the head which required approximately 40 stitches, fractured vertebrae, and 3 to 4 compressed discs. A lack of covers on temporary floor openings led to the accident.
